Power steering belt squeal

Asked by Grotty8675309 Jul 14, 2020 at 10:00 PM about the 2001 Hyundai Elantra GL Sedan FWD

Question type: Maintenance & Repair

Out of ideas at this point. Thought power
steering pump was bad and replaced it as
well a fluid flush. Have went through 4
different belts. The squeal will stop with a
new belt anywhere from 1 day to about a
week. Then it starts to squeal again. I then
replaced the pulley on the pump with a new
belt. This lasted a couple of days as well. I
had my son turn the steering wheel while
watching under the hood, you can
physically watch the pulley slow down or
even stop while under load while the belt
just slips around the pulley.  Running out of
ideas at this point and asking for help
please.

You can buy a can of Belt dressing at your local auto parts store also I would spray a little wd40 on the idler pulleys. Be careful not to spray the wd on the belts

55

Sounds like the pulley is bad or the tensioner spring is bad
